Peer reviewedSwetz, Frank J.; Meerah, Tamby Subahan Mohd – Science Education, 1982
Curriculum planning, even in a developed country, is not without problems. Curriculum planners in developing countries are faced with dilemmas at almost every level of decision making. The revision of the Malaysian physics curriculum is detailed in this article. (PB)

Peer reviewedDekkers, John; Rouse, Fae – Australian Science Teachers Journal, 1977
Provides a detailed description of the three-year Foundational Approaches in Science Education curriculum developed at the University of Hawaii. The program utilizes a spiral approach with topics in ecology, physical science and relational study. Sample units and implementation suggestions are provided. (CP)

Peer reviewedKazanjian, Wendy C. – Science and Children, 1982
Describes Project COLD (Climate, Ocean, Land, Discovery) a scientific study of the Polar Regions, a collection of 35 modules used within the framework of existing subjects: oceanography, biology, geology, meterology, geography, social science. Includes a partial list of topics and one activity (geodesic dome) from a module. (Author/SK)
